Hi,
I just noticed an inconvenience with regexp searching and the ß char.
Try this: C-M-s (isearch-forward-regexp) with [[:lower:][:digit]]
now:
This is a sentence. All lower chars (like abc or ß !) and
digits like 123 should be matched.
Well, ß is not matched.
I found some info regarding that problem, e.g.
http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/emacs-devel/2009-11/msg00460.html
Yes, ß is problematic (no uppercase version, should be replaced with
SS, but not all SS are ß etc. etc.), but I have to guess german emacs
users must have figured out what to do about this already.
So, what do you do?
Do you use the uppercase ß char in your standard-case-table?
Do you suffer from performance issues doing so?
